The water used to brew coffee causes limescale buildup inside your machine. Use descaling solution, vinegar, citric acid, or bottled lemon juice to descale. In general, you should descale your coffee maker about once a month if you brew coffee daily. Tetro says you can descale a coffee maker by running a brew cycle with one part water to one part vinegar.
